Essay Recommending The Union Of Great Britain And Her Colonies And The United States: And The Final Union Of The World Into One Great Nation is a thought-provoking book written by Francis Vincent in 1870. The book presents a compelling argument for the unification of Great Britain, her colonies, and the United States, as well as the ultimate merging of all nations into one global entity.Vincent's essay explores the benefits of a unified world, including the elimination of war, the promotion of free trade, and the spread of democracy. He argues that a united world would be more prosperous, peaceful, and just than the current system of nation-states.The author also provides a historical context for his argument, tracing the evolution of political and economic systems from ancient times to the present day. He examines the successes and failures of various political systems and argues that a unified world would be the best way to achieve lasting peace and prosperity.Vincent's book is a fascinating exploration of political theory and history. It offers a unique perspective on the challenges facing humanity and proposes a bold solution to these challenges.
